Surrounded by the natural beauty of Yufuin, this contemporary art museum is known for the harmony between its architecture and contemporary art. It opened in 2017 and held its grand opening in 2022 after expanding its exhibition area.

Designed by world-renowned architect Kengo Kuma, the museum features a series of small roofs that help it blend into Yufuin’s village landscape. Its exterior walls use charred cedar, and the interior highlights natural materials such as wood, earth, washi paper, and water.

Inside the museum, long-term exhibitions feature works by eight leading Japanese contemporary artists, including Yayoi Kusama, Yoshitomo Nara, Takashi Murakami, Hiroshi Sugimoto, and Tatsuo Miyajima. Beyond the artworks, major highlights include the majestic view of Mount Yufu through the windows and the architecture itself, which skillfully incorporates light, wind, and water.

The museum also has a cafe and shop. Through the cafe’s large windows, sweeping views of Mount Yufu unfold, allowing visitors to spend a relaxed time while taking in a landscape where art and nature coexist.

Wrapped in Yufuin’s peaceful natural setting, it is one of Kyushu’s leading art spots, offering both some of Japan’s finest contemporary art and architectural beauty in one visit.

Highlights

  • A contemporary art museum located in Yufuin, a hot spring town in Yufu City, Oita Prefecture.
  • Opened in 2017, with an expanded exhibition area added in 2022.
  • Designed by world-renowned architect Kengo Kuma.
  • Permanently exhibits works by eight leading Japanese contemporary artists.
  • Visitors can enjoy the location overlooking Mount Yufu, contemporary art, and Kengo Kuma’s architecture all together.

Details

Name in Japanese
COMICO ART MUSEUM YUFUIN
Postal Code
879-5102
Address
2995-1 Kawakami, Yufuin-cho, Yufu City, Oita Prefecture
Closed on
Every other Wednesday
Hours
9:30am-5:00pm (Last admission at 4:00pm)
Admission
1,700 yen; university and vocational school students 1,200 yen; junior high and high school students 1,000 yen; elementary school students 700 yen; preschool children free; visitors with a disability certificate (general admission, certificate holder only) 1,200 yen
Access
Approx. 10-minute walk from JR Yufuin Station
